Understanding Common Problems



Recognizing usual issues in packaging makers is crucial for preserving operational performance and decreasing downtime. Product packaging makers, important to production lines, can run into a range of issues that impede their efficiency. One widespread problem is mechanical malfunction, commonly arising from deterioration on components such as equipments and belts, which can result in inconsistent product packaging quality.


One more typical problem is imbalance, where the product packaging products might not align correctly, creating jams or incorrect sealing. This imbalance can come from improper setup or changes in material specifications. In addition, electrical failures, such as malfunctioning sensors or control systems, can interfere with the maker's automated procedures, causing manufacturing delays.


Operators may likewise experience challenges with software application problems, which can affect equipment programming and functionality. Poor upkeep methods commonly contribute to these issues, emphasizing the demand for regular inspections and prompt service treatments. By understanding these usual concerns, operators can execute proactive measures to make sure peak performance, thus lowering pricey downtimes and improving general performance in packaging operations.

Diagnostic Tools and Techniques



Reliable troubleshooting of packaging makers relies heavily on a variety of analysis tools and methods that help with the recognition of underlying concerns - packaging machine repair service. Among the primary tools is the use of software analysis programs, which can keep an eye on equipment efficiency, evaluate mistake codes, and provide real-time data analytics. These programs enable professionals to identify specific malfunctions quickly, significantly lowering downtime


Along with software application multimeters, oscilloscopes and options are important for electric diagnostics. Multimeters can gauge voltage, present, and resistance, aiding to identify electrical mistakes in circuits. Oscilloscopes, on the other hand, offer visualization of electrical signals, making it simpler to discover abnormalities in waveforms.


Mechanical concerns can be diagnosed making use of resonance analysis devices and thermal imaging electronic cameras. Vibration evaluation permits the detection of discrepancies or misalignments in equipment, while thermal imaging helps determine overheating parts that may result in mechanical failure.


Last but not least, aesthetic assessments, incorporated with typical checklists, remain vital for standard troubleshooting. This thorough technique to diagnostics ensures that specialists can effectively address a vast array of issues, consequently enhancing the integrity and performance of packaging equipments.

Upkeep Finest Practices



Constant upkeep techniques are crucial for taking full advantage of the effectiveness and lifespan of product packaging machines. Establishing a comprehensive upkeep routine is the initial action toward making sure ideal performance. This routine must consist of daily, weekly, and month-to-month jobs tailored to the details device and its functional demands.


Daily checks ought to concentrate on important elements such as sensing units, seals, and belts, ensuring they are clean and operating properly. Weekly upkeep may involve evaluating lubrication degrees and tightening loose fittings, while month-to-month tasks need to include more comprehensive assessments, such as positioning checks and software updates.




Making use of a list can enhance these procedures, making sure no vital tasks are neglected. Furthermore, preserving exact records of maintenance activities assists determine persisting problems and informs future methods.


Training team on correct use and handling can substantially minimize wear and tear, avoiding unneeded failures. Investing in high-quality components and lubricants can boost device performance and reliability.
